How do I get to El Nido Resorts?
The most common way to get to El Nido, Palawan, is by taking a plane from Manila to Puerto Princesa, and then taking a van from Puerto Princesa to El Nido. It will take you a day, but it’s the cheapest way to go. Another good option is to take a direct flight from Manila to El Nido.
How do I book El Nido?
You can book through Philippine Airlines, Cebu Pacific, or AirAsia. Once in Puerto Princesa airport, you will need to ride a van or bus for 5-7 hours going to El Nido. Vans are the most popular option among travelers for land travel to El Nido because it’s slightly faster than the bus with a travel time of 5-6 hours.
Is El Nido an island?
El Nido is a coastal settlement and major tourist destination on the Philippines island of Palawan. El Nido comprises 45 islands and islets; limestone cliffs are also found here, which form a Karst backdrop similar to those found in Ha Long Bay, Krabi and Guilin.

Is it safe to travel to Palawan Philippines?
Compared to other Filipino destinations, Palawan is one of the safest places for tourists that are seeking a tropical holiday. There are few safety risks, but if you’re vigilant and follow the instructions of your tour guide, it’s very unlikely that you’ll encounter danger.
How much does it cost to go to El Nido Palawan?
A vacation to El Nido for one week usually costs around ₱12,443 for one person. So, a trip to El Nido for two people costs around ₱24,885 for one week. A trip for two weeks for two people costs ₱49,771 in El Nido.
